Key Advantages of Wire Laser Technology Over Traditional Methods

Unlocking Precision: How Wire Laser Machines Transform Metal Fabrication in 2023 Wire laser tech is really shaking up metal fabrication in 2023, and honestly, it's bringing some pretty awesome advantages over the old-school cutting methods. One thing that stands out is just how precise these lasers are—they cut so accurately that you waste less material, and the edges come out super clean. That kind of precision is a big deal for industries like aerospace and auto manufacturing, where tight tolerances and top-notch finishes are a must.

Plus, wire lasers are faster than traditional tools, meaning you can get things done quicker and turn around projects in no time.

If you're looking to get the most out of wire laser technology, a good tip is to stay on top of maintenance. Regularly cleaning and calibrating your equipment can really make a difference—it keeps the cuts sharp and helps the machine last longer. Also, trying out adaptive cutting strategies—like adjusting speed and power based on how thick the material is—can seriously boost efficiency. It’s all about managing resources smarter and cutting down operational costs. Following these simple best practices can really help manufacturers tap into the full potential of wire lasers.

Step-by-Step Guide: Setting Up Your Wire Laser Machine for Optimal Performance

Getting your wire laser machine set up for top-notch performance isn't a walk in the park — it takes some thoughtful planning and a bit of hands-on effort. First off, make sure your workspace is tidy and well-organized; it just makes everything way easier, you know, with tools and materials at your fingertips. Start by double-checking the calibration on the machine — trust me, that’s super important for clean, precise cuts. You'll also want to tweak the lens and focus based on the wire size and the kind of metal you're working with. Don’t forget, keeping the machine in good shape not only helps it last longer but also keeps it running smoothly. So, do regular check-ups, especially on the cooling system, and swap out any worn-out parts before they cause problems.

Now, moving onto the software settings — this part can really make or break your results. Choose the right cutting parameters depending on how thick the metal is and what kind of finish you're aiming for. Setting the correct feed rate, power level, and pulse duration makes a big difference in the final quality. It’s a good idea to run some test cuts first — that way, you can fine-tune everything for different projects. And if you’re training someone else to operate the machine, make sure they understand these settings, so you reduce waste and keep things running smoothly. Basically, a bit of extra effort here can save you a headache down the road and help you get the best results on every project.
